Genome sequencing is routine, however genome assembly still remains a challenge despite the computational advances of the last decade. In particular, the abundance of repeat elements in the genome make it difficult to assemble a single complete sequence. Identical repeats shorter than the average read length will generally be assembled without issue. However, longer repeats such as transposons, insertion elements, or ribosomal RNA (rrn) operons that may extend for several kilobases cannot be accurately assembled using existing tools. The application scaffold_builder was designed to generate scaffolds – super contigs of sequences joined by N bases – from draft genomes. The application was evaluated with two newly sequenced Salmonella genomes. Availability and Implementation: scaffold_builder was written in Python and can be downloaded from http://edwards.sdsu.edu/research/scaffold_builder . Contact: redwards@cs.sdsu.edu
